While shopping, I noticed the enthusiastic reviews for this fryer. It’s justified. Totally satisfied customer. I’d like to offer some tips from a beginner viewpoint. * Upon unpacking, completely wash and dry all usual parts. * Reassemble unit and take outside where electricity is available. Run the Max Crisp function for 15 mins. The stench is common to many air fryers. Allow Ninja to cool and air out before washing and drying again. * Consider the accessories I recommend here. A must have is a set of silicone tipped tongs. Plastic and nylon will melt and metal will scratch the basket. * A meat thermometer will assist you in getting consistent results, no raw chicken. * Accessory kits will enable you to try new ideas like baking or making kabobs. Very handy. Seriously, I haven’t found a thing I would change about theMax XL. These exact accessories are highly recommended!

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] I was so excited to try this air fryer after reading reviews and watching something on tv that featured one, but my feelings are mixed after cooking several things in it. So far, I've made both regular and sweet potato fries, the broccoli recipe that comes in the cookbook and chocolate soufflé. Each time the cooking time has been off and I've had to guess at the adjustment... both times the fries were half over-cooked and half-undercooked, the soufflé was over-cooked and the broccoli was way over-cooked... I'm chalking this up to a learning-curve and will keep trying. I have other Ninja products and LOVE them and the quality of the construction of this fryer is excellent. However, there is an off-gassing smell while the fryer is cooking that I'm hoping diminishes with use, and both my husband and I have noticed on all the foods that there's an "off" taste that can only be described as "chemical" like the coating of the main cooking unit... also hoping this diminishes with use.
